Output 66f7dc82b8021c0d68d644345aa84e933940524aec29baead35c7328411cd96d:29

value
3766
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8ba317173fcb5070d9c6af78356c058c95049e8b5883217955663d1525cfe16
address
bc1pmzarzutnlj6swrvudtmcx4kqtry4qj0gkkyry9u42e3az5julctq79xh2j
transaction
66f7dc82b8021c0d68d644345aa84e933940524aec29baead35c7328411cd96d
spent
true